Class II โ€” Potential Health Hazard

Potential health hazard โ€” use of or exposure to this product may cause temporary or medically reversible adverse health consequences.

Lansoprazole Delayed-Release Orally Disintegrating Tablets Recalled by Dr. Reddy's Laboratories, Inc. Due to Failed Dissolution Specifications

Date: April 15, 2022
Company: Dr. Reddy's Laboratories, Inc.
Status: Terminated
Source: FDA (Drug)

What You Should Do

Stop using this product immediately. Do not consume, use, or distribute it.

Return the product to the place of purchase for a full refund. If you have questions, contact Dr. Reddy's Laboratories, Inc. directly.

Affected Products

Lansoprazole Delayed-Release Orally Disintegrating Tablets, 30 mg, 10 Packs of 10 Tablets each, 100 Tablets per blister pack, Rx Only, Distributed by: Dr. Reddy's Laboratories, Inc., Princeton, NJ 08540, Made in India, NDC 43598-561-78.

Quantity: 252 Blister Packs

Why Was This Recalled?

Failed Dissolution Specifications

Where Was This Sold?

This product was distributed to 1 state: OH
